  The decline in gold prices due to risk aversion and cooling is also limited

Gold prices have once again reached a historic high, despite the United States3The employment growth in the month was strong, but multiple factors including US interest rate cuts, speculative buying, and central bank purchases have led to record high gold prices. Geopolitical turmoil has also provided strong upward momentum for gold prices.

For this week, the market will welcome the United StatesCPIInvestors need to pay close attention to the data and minutes of the Federal Reserve meeting, as well as the interest rate resolutions of the Federal Reserve of New Zealand, the Bank of Canada, and the European Central Bank.

Considering that the impact of geopolitical conditions on gold prices is generally brief, and that US economic data is relatively strong, the Federal Reserve6The expectation of monthly interest rate cuts has cooled down, and after the continuous rise in oil prices, there are signs of a rebound in US inflation growth. In addition, Federal Reserve officials have given hawkish speeches, suggesting that there is a possibility of gold prices rising and falling or fluctuating at high levels this week.

United States3The monthly employment growth far exceeded expectations and wages steadily increased, indicating a stable economic performance at the end of the first quarter, which may prompt the Federal Reserve Board of the United States(Federal Reserve/FED)Delay the expected interest rate cut that is expected to begin this year.

The highly anticipated employment report released by the Ministry of Labor last Friday also showed that,3Monthly unemployment rate from2Of3.9%lower3.8%. The decline in unemployment rate reflects a significant rebound in household employment, and the economy has easily absorbed it46.9Ten thousand new labor force.

The unemployment rate in the United States has been continuous26Keep at4%The duration is1960The longest since the end of the decade. Although the Federal Reserve has since2022year3The interest rate has been raised since the beginning of the month525To curb inflation, the US economy is still far ahead globally. The labor market has benefited from an increase in the number of immigrants over the past year.

Although the strong recruitment campaign has not changed expectations that the Federal Reserve will begin to relax policies this year in the face of an increase in labor supply, financial markets are skeptical of the three rate cuts expected by decision-makers.

The US Department of Labor's Bureau of Labor Statistics states that,3Monthly increase in non farm employment opportunities30.3Ten thousand, the economists surveyed are expected to increase20Ten thousand, specific predictions in1510000 to25Between ten thousand.1Month and2The number of new job opportunities per month is higher than previously announced2.2Ten thousand.

  Middle East situation eases, oil prices fall back

Oil prices have fallen by more than2%The tension in the Middle East has eased after Israel withdrew more soldiers from southern Gaza and promised new negotiations on a possible ceasefire.

Israel and Hamas have dispatched teams to Egypt to negotiate a new round of ceasefire that could be reached before the Eid al Fitr holiday, easing tensions in the Middle East.

  IGMarket analystTony Sycamore"Israel claims to have withdrawn all troops except for one brigade from southern Gaza, possibly in response to increasing international pressure or to ease tensions after Israel killed a senior Iranian commander in Syria last week. This event seems to be a catalyst for the decline in oil prices," he said

Israel Sunday(4month7day)It is stated that more soldiers have been withdrawn from southern Gaza, and currently only one brigade's strength remains;At the same time, Israel and Hamas respectively dispatched negotiation teams to Egypt for a new round of ceasefire negotiations.

Since the beginning of this year, Israel has been reducing the number of soldiers stationed in Gaza to ease the pressure on reserve personnel, and Israel is facing increasing pressure from its ally, the United States, to improve the humanitarian situation, especially after seven aid workers were killed last week.

The military spokesperson did not provide a detailed explanation of the reasons for the withdrawal or the number of people involved. But Secretary of Defense Galant(Yoav Gallant)These troops will prepare for future operations in Gaza.

Both Israel and Hamas have confirmed that they will send a delegation to Egypt. Hamas hopes to reach an agreement that will end the war and allow Israel to withdraw its troops. Israel has stated that it will overthrow Hamas after reaching any ceasefire agreement.

Israeli Prime Minister Netanyahu has stated that if the hostages are not released, the agreement will be waived and he will not yield to international pressure. Hamas stated that the agreement must include freedom of movement for the entire Gaza Strip population.

Approximately130The hostage is still being held in Gaza. When asked about the withdrawal of troops from Gaza, the Israeli Chief of General StaffHerzi HaleviThe military is adjusting its methods to cope with this long-term resistance war, according to reporters.

Galant stated that Israel will continue to advance this war until Hamas no longer controls Gaza or poses a threat to Israel as a military group. According to a statement released by Galant's office, Galant stated during a meeting with military officials, "The troops are withdrawing and preparing to proceed with the next mission as well as the upcoming mission in the Rafah area."

Baker Hughes(Baker Hughes)Last Friday, in its report, it was reported that the US oil drilling platform increased by two last week, reaching508And the number of natural gas drilling platforms decreased by two, to110For2022year1The lowest since the beginning of the month.
